About South Korean Won (KRW)

The South Korean Won (KRW) is the official currency issued by the central bank. It plays a vital role in the global economy and international trade. The exchange rate of South Korean Won against major currencies like USD, EUR, and CNY is closely watched by forex traders worldwide. Factors affecting the KRW exchange rate include interest rate decisions, inflation data, and GDP growth.

About Indonesian Rupiah (IDR)

The Indonesian Rupiah (IDR) is the legal tender. Its exchange rate is influenced by various economic factors including monetary policy, trade balance, and market sentiment. The IDR/KRW exchange rate is important for businesses engaged in international trade and cross-border investments.
